Tips on Navigating Yosemite
Here are tips on how to better enjoy your visit provided by Yosemite National Park:
- Text ynptraffic to 333111 for updates on current Yosemite traffic conditions.
- Each year, Yosemite National Park welcomes more than four million visitors. During summer, expect extended traffic delays, limited parking, busy trails, and no lodging or campground availability. It’s best to arrive by 8 a.m. or in the afternoon to avoid delays.
- Ride a YARTS bus to enter the park.
- If you drive, park your car for the duration of your stay. Free shuttles can help you get around Yosemite Valley, but they will be full on busy days. You may need to wait for multiple buses to go by before one has space for you. Consider walking or biking.
- Bring plenty of food and water for potential delays and stop and use restrooms when they are available.
- Enjoy the entire Yosemite region. Consider visiting gateway communities and their visitor centers in Mariposa, Groveland, Mono County, and Oakhurst.
